    A reanalysis of pp amplitudes for all important partial waves below about 2 GeV is presented. A set of once subtracted dispersion relations with imposed crossing symmetry condition is used to modify unitary multichannel amplitudes in the S, P, D, and F waves. So far, these specific amplitudes constructed in our works and many other analyses have been fitted only to experimental data and therefore do not fulfill the crossing symmetry condition. In the present analysis, the self-consistent, i. e., unitary and fulfilling the crossing symmetry, amplitudes for the S, P, D, and F waves are formed. The proposed very effective and simple method of modification of the pi pi amplitudes does not change their previous original mathematical structure, and the method can be easily applied in various other analyses.
